Transaction aca556edbe84686250b2e42382a477f65ba28b01040820a37edf62436b9abe6e
1 Input
1 Output
-
aca556edbe84686250b2e42382a477f65ba28b01040820a37edf62436b9abe6e:0
- value
- 66720139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03d384e0d030f8b1e70311b662dd6d7bbdf433bc OP_EQUAL
- address
- M8FPecBCL35VSVWNrRevVxneNaAtF9v9BE